Ingredients & Equipment Needed For This Recipe
Ingredients:
- Ripe Avocados– If they are a little bit hard that’s okay. This is a creamy mixture so it will be blended up.
- Lime Juice– Can either use fresh lime juice or from the bottle.
- Jalapeño– If you don’t like spicy you can use less or omit completely.
- Cilantro– I like to trim my cilantro so that I’m just getting the leaves, not the stem.
- Red Onion
- Fresh Garlic
- Salt & Pepper- Just to taste.
Equipment:
- Large Mixing Bowl– Used to gather all of your ingredients before they all go into the food processor, or to be mixed in that bowl.
- Food Processor– If you’d like a more chunky guacamole you can use a Potato Masher instead.
- Rubber Spatula– To scrape all the chunks and to remove from the processor.
- Cutting Board & Sharp Knife– For cutting your vegetables in the recipe.



My Kinda Professional Tips For 10 Minute Creamy Guacamole
- This is a pretty customizable recipe. Whether you like it smooth or chunky is all up to you! You can also choose to add more or less of any element. This is just how I like it and hope you do too!
- This guacamole will keep in the fridge for 3 days in a close-able container and plastic wrap on top.
10 Minute Creamy Guacamole
Make your day or night better with this 10 minute creamy guacamole. This simple yet satisfying recipe can be added to your taco night as a simple appetizer or just as an easy snack!
Ingredients
- 2 each Ripe Avocados
- 1 each Lime, 2 Tbl juice
- 1/2 each Red Onion
- 1/4 Cup Chopped Cilantro
- 2-3 cloves Raw Garlic
- 1/2 each Jalapeño, de-seeded
- to taste Salt & Pepper
Instructions
- Gather all of the ingredients and give them a rough chop. Place them in the food processor and pulse for 15-20 seconds.
- Take the rubber spatula and give the mixture a scrape to get any big chunks of anything. Continue to pulse for 15-30 seconds, or until smooth.
- Place in the serving dish of your choice.
Notes
1 Serving= 1/4 cup Creamy Guacamole
